The source news reports that AutoZone (AZO) stock is experiencing a significant decline even as the company’s latest earnings performance appeared robust. The headline from Yahoo Finance highlights a clear disconnect between the earnings result and the stock price movement, indicating that investors may be focusing on other aspects of the business or broader market conditions. No additional details were provided in the original news item beyond the headline, leaving the precise reasons for the stock’s drop open to interpretation. However, such a pattern is not uncommon in financial markets, where profit-taking, forward guidance, or sector-wide trends can override positive earnings news. AutoZone, as a leading auto parts retailer, operates in a competitive and cyclical industry, and its stock performance often reflects not just current earnings but also expectations for future growth.

Key takeaways from the limited information include: (1) AutoZone’s earnings were described as “strong,” indicating that fundamental operational metrics—such as revenue, net income, or comparable-store sales—likely exceeded expectations or marked an improvement over prior periods. (2) Despite this, the stock’s sharp decline suggests that market participants may be reacting to other factors such as management’s forward outlook, inventory management concerns, or macroeconomic headwinds affecting consumer spending on vehicle maintenance. (3) The exact catalysts for the sell-off are not specified in the source, but examples of common post-earnings stock drops include disappointed guidance for future quarters, margin compression from rising costs, or a broader rotation out of the retail sector. Investors should interpret the stock movement as a signal to examine more recent company filings and sector trends for clues.
